Pancytopenia's underlying severity and urgency directly shapes the entire treatment landscape — because aplastic anemia is a rare, life-threatening condition marked by pancytopenia and bone marrow hypocellularity, and because untreated severe disease carries very high mortality risk from complications including profound fatigue, life-threatening infection susceptibility, and hemorrhage, treatment decisions must be made relatively quickly once diagnosis is confirmed, with the specific choice between treatment pathways carrying genuinely significant consequences for long-term patient survival. The newly published 2026 ASH guidelines establish a clear treatment hierarchy prioritizing transplantation for eligible younger patients — the guideline panel's 33 recommendations emphasize hematopoietic cell transplantation (HCT) as the preferred approach for younger individuals who have an available matched sibling or matched unrelated donor, while immunosuppressive therapy (IST) remains the primary approach for patients without a suitable donor or who are not otherwise eligible for transplantation, with HCT also recommended as a second-line option specifically following failure of initial immunosuppressive therapy. Eltrombopag's incorporation into standard first-line immunosuppressive regimens represents one of the most clinically significant and evidence-supported recent treatment developments — this oral thrombopoietin receptor agonist, which stimulates bone marrow stem cells to increase production of platelets, red cells, and white cells through mechanisms distinct from its originally approved indication in immune thrombocytopenia, was specifically validated in the RACE trial (a randomized, multicenter European study), which found that adding eltrombopag to standard antithymocyte globulin plus cyclosporine immunosuppressive therapy improved the rate, speed, and strength of hematologic response among previously untreated severe aplastic anemia patients without adding meaningful toxicity, evidence that directly informed the new 2026 ASH guideline recommendation to incorporate eltrombopag into standard immunosuppressive regimens going forward. A genuinely important and clinically significant caveat runs throughout the new guidelines, one the panel itself explicitly acknowledges — for most of the 33 clinical recommendations, the certainty of underlying evidence was rated as low or very low, largely reflecting the field's continued reliance on small, non-randomized studies rather than large-scale randomized controlled trials, a limitation directly attributable to aplastic anemia's genuine rarity, which makes recruiting sufficiently large patient cohorts for high-certainty randomized trials a persistent and difficult challenge across this entire rare disease category. Relapse and treatment-refractory disease remain significant ongoing clinical challenges even with modern immunosuppressive protocols — relapse occurs in up to one-third of patients following initial severe aplastic anemia treatment, though a second course of immunosuppressive therapy can be effective in 55-60% of relapsed patients, while eltrombopag specifically has shown the ability to produce clinically significant blood count improvement in nearly half of patients whose aplastic anemia remains refractory to standard immunosuppressive therapy alone, offering a meaningful additional option for this particularly difficult-to-treat patient subgroup.

What causes pancytopenia, and what is the newly published treatment guidance from the American Society of Hematology? Pancytopenia — a simultaneous deficiency in red blood cells, white blood cells, and platelets — is most commonly caused by aplastic anemia, a rare and life-threatening disorder in which the bone marrow fails to produce enough of all three blood cell types, resulting in bone marrow hypocellularity (a marrow with far fewer blood-cell-producing cells than normal). The American Society of Hematology's newly published 2026 clinical practice guidelines for severe and very severe acquired aplastic anemia establish 33 specific recommendations covering diagnostic testing, treatment strategy selection, and supportive care. The guidelines prioritize hematopoietic cell transplantation for younger patients who have an available matched sibling or matched unrelated donor, recommend immunosuppressive therapy (typically antithymocyte globulin plus cyclosporine) as the primary approach for patients without a suitable transplant donor, and specifically recommend incorporating the oral drug eltrombopag into standard immunosuppressive regimens based on clinical trial evidence showing improved treatment response.

What is eltrombopag, and why has it become an important addition to standard aplastic anemia treatment? Eltrombopag (marketed as Promacta) is an oral thrombopoietin receptor agonist — a drug that mimics the body's natural thrombopoietin protein, which stimulates bone marrow stem cells to produce blood cells. Originally developed and approved for a different condition (immune thrombocytopenia), eltrombopag was subsequently studied in aplastic anemia based on the theory that stimulating remaining bone marrow stem cells could help restore blood cell production even in this bone-marrow-failure condition. The pivotal RACE trial, a randomized, multicenter European study, found that adding eltrombopag to standard antithymocyte globulin and cyclosporine immunosuppressive therapy improved the rate, speed, and strength of blood count recovery in previously untreated severe aplastic anemia patients without significant added toxicity — evidence that directly supported its incorporation into the newly published 2026 ASH treatment guidelines. Separately, eltrombopag has also shown meaningful benefit specifically in patients whose aplastic anemia remains refractory (resistant) to standard immunosuppressive therapy alone, producing clinically significant blood count improvement in nearly half of these particularly difficult-to-treat patients.
